Comparing RTP Rates in Different Roulette Forms

When comparing RTP rates in diverse roulette versions, understanding their distinct structures aids clarify why they offer distinct returns.

European Roulette, with its one zero, generally features an RTP of 97.3%, offering a higher return compared to American Roulette’s 94.74%, which has a dual zero.

French Roulette presents similar mechanics to the European type but frequently boasts an added advantage with the “La Partage” rule, somewhat improving the RTP for even-odds bets.

Then there’s Mini Roulette, a variant with less numbers, causing an RTP lower than its broader counterparts.
